ADSL, bits et bytes
[en]Don’t confuse bits and bytes like me. 1B (Byte) = 8b (bits). A 2000Kb/s DSL connection will only download 250KB/s, and that’s normal.[fr]Je viens d’apprendre quelque chose. Je sais que j’ai une ligne ADSL “2000/100″, ce que j’ai toujours traduit … Continue reading
